Highlights
Are people in Redlands older or younger than people in Cumming?
- The Median Age in Redlands is 4.5 years younger than in Cumming.

Are housing costs cheaper in Redlands or Cumming?
- Redlands housing costs are 12.7% more expensive than Cumming hous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Redlands or Cumming?
- The average commute for residents of Redlands is 0.0 minutes longer than it is for residents of Cumming.

Things to do in Redlands?
Redlands, California is a vibrant city located in the West United States. Home to attractions such as Prospect Park and A.K. Smiley Public Library, visitors can enjoy outdoor activities and nature when visiting Redlands. There are also plenty of museums, galleries, and performance venues such as Wabash Avenue Redlands Art Association and Morey Family Art Museum. For entertainment, visitors can explore downtown shopping districts and restaurants along with movie theaters and live music clubs.
